Date: Monday, January 31, 2022 @ 17:02:55 Author: eworm Revision: 1121255
archrelease: copy trunk to community-testing-x86_64 Added: at/repos/community-testing-x86_64/ at/repos/community-testing-x86_64/80-atd.hook (from rev 1121254, at/trunk/80-atd.hook) at/repos/community-testing-x86_64/PKGBUILD (from rev 1121254, at/trunk/PKGBUILD) at/repos/community-testing-x86_64/pam.conf (from rev 1121254, at/trunk/pam.conf) -------------+ 80-atd.hook | 9 +++++++++ PKGBUILD | 48 ++++++++++++++++++++++++++++++++++++++++++++++++ pam.conf | 12 ++++++++++++ 3 files changed, 69 insertions(+) Copied: at/repos/community-testing-x86_64/80-atd.hook (from rev 1121254, at/trunk/80-atd.hook) =================================================================== --- community-testing-x86_64/80-atd.hook (rev 0) +++ community-testing-x86_64/80-atd.hook 2022-01-31 17:02:55 UTC (rev 1121255) @@ -0,0 +1,9 @@ +[Trigger] +Operation = Upgrade +Type = Package +Target = glibc + +[Action] +Description = Restarting atd for libc upgrade... +When = PostTransaction +Exec = /usr/bin/systemctl try-restart atd.service Copied: at/repos/community-testing-x86_64/PKGBUILD (from rev 1121254, at/trunk/PKGBUILD) =================================================================== --- community-testing-x86_64/PKGBUILD (rev 0) +++ community-testing-x86_64/PKGBUILD 2022-01-31 17:02:55 UTC (rev 1121255) @@ -0,0 +1,48 @@ +# Maintainer: Alexander F Rødseth <xypr...@archlinux.org> +# Contributor: Nathan Baum <n...@p12a.org.uk> +# Contributor: Judd Vinet <jvi...@zeroflux.org> +# Contributor: Todd Musall <tmus...@comcast.net> + +pkgname=at +pkgver=3.2.4 +pkgrel=1 +pkgdesc='AT and batch delayed command scheduling utility and daemon' +arch=('x86_64') +url='https://salsa.debian.org/debian/at' +license=('GPL') +depends=('pam' 'flex') +makedepends=('smtp-forwarder' 'git' 'systemd') +backup=('etc/at.deny' + 'etc/pam.d/atd' + 'var/spool/atd/.SEQ') +options=('!makeflags') +validpgpkeys=('464BC7CD439FEE5E8B4098A0348A778D6885EF8F') # Jose M Calhariz (Técnico) <jose.calha...@tecnico.ulisboa.pt> +source=("http://software.calhariz.com/$pkgname/${pkgname}_${pkgver}.orig.tar.gz"{,.asc} + '80-atd.hook' + 'pam.conf') +sha256sums=('76990cbb6f4b9bfedb926637904fdcc0d4fa20b6596b9c932117a49a0624c684' + 'SKIP' + 'a7048d6dbd8aa4d881979716829d16053b5007c2d83eb2167edd5221f9e48a33' + 'e51630c26765e88bc9c3046c62bf12c56d9863f22bcf04eb00ccd5eb421c7e18') + +build() { + cd "$pkgname-$pkgver" + + ./configure \ + --prefix=/usr \ + --sbindir=/usr/bin \ + --with-jobdir=/var/spool/atd \ + --with-atspool=/var/spool/atd \ + --with-systemdsystemunitdir=/usr/lib/systemd/system + + CFLAGS="$CFLAGS -w" make +} + +package() { + make -C "$pkgname-$pkgver" IROOT="$pkgdir" docdir=/usr/share/doc install + + install -D -m0644 pam.conf "$pkgdir"/etc/pam.d/atd + install -D -m0644 80-atd.hook "$pkgdir"/usr/share/libalpm/hooks/80-atd.hook +} + +# vim:set ts=2 sw=2 et: Copied: at/repos/community-testing-x86_64/pam.conf (from rev 1121254, at/trunk/pam.conf) =================================================================== --- community-testing-x86_64/pam.conf (rev 0) +++ community-testing-x86_64/pam.conf 2022-01-31 17:02:55 UTC (rev 1121255) @@ -0,0 +1,12 @@ +#%PAM-1.0 + +auth required pam_unix.so +auth required pam_env.so user_readenv=1 + +account required pam_access.so +account required pam_unix.so +account required pam_time.so + +session required pam_loginuid.so +session required pam_limits.so +session required pam_unix.so